1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a virus?
Back
A virus is a non-living infectious agent that requires a host cell to replicate and cannot be classified as a cell.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the process called when a virus changes over time?
Back
Mutation.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the three main shapes of bacteria?
Back
Rod, sphere, spiral.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Are viruses considered living or non-living?
Back
Non-living.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What happens to a host cell when a virus infects it?
Back
The virus destroys and damages the host cell.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the outer protein coat of a virus called?
Back
Capsid.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do bacteria reproduce?
Back
Bacteria reproduce asexually through a process called binary fission.
